UM348x Multi-Instrument Melody Generator
Features
Powered by a 1.5V battery
Low standby current
512-note memory, up to 16 songs
8 playing modes by user setting
One built-in RC oscillator
8 beats selectable
3 timbres - piano, organ, and mandolin
5 tempos available through mask setting
14 tones selectable
On-chip envelope modulator and pre-amplifier
General Description
The M3481 series is a mask-ROM-programmed multi-instrument melody generator , implemented by
CMOS technology. It is designed to play the melody according to the previously programmed
information
and is capable of generating 16 songs with 3 instrument effects : piano, organ and mandolin. The
device
also includes a pre-amplifier which provides a simple interface to the driver circuit. The M3481 series is
intended for applications such as toys, door bells, music box, melody clock/timers and telephones.
Absolute Maximum Ratings
DC Supply Voltage .......................................... -0.3V to +5.0V
Input Voltage Range ....................................... Vss-0.3V to Vdd+0.3V
Operating Ambient Temperature .................... 0
°
C to +70
°
C
Storage Temperature ....................................... -10
°
C to +125
°
C
